Christopher Bell speaks out about crew chief Adam Stevens being benched due to a severe knee injury.

While every other NASCAR Cup Series teams are returning to the Richmond Cup race after a two-week break for the Olympics with a fully refreshed crew, Joe Gibbs Racing’s star driver is returning without his regular crew chief, who is unable to travel with the No:20 crew due to health reasons.

Adam Stevens injured both of his knees during his vacation with his family and had to undergo surgery. JGR revealed that he will miss live action for several upcoming weekends. However, Stevens will still be involved in Christopher Bell’s campaign by guiding the team from the war room at JGR HQ.

Christopher Bell discussed the absence of his crew chief at Richmond Raceway before race day. Despite Stevens’ absence, he believes the team will be fine. As long as the crew chief is available at the Huntersville war room and there are no technical difficulties, it will not impact the team’s performance.

The No:20 Toyota driver previously shared how he learned about the injury. He revealed that the news was shared through the No:20 team group chat, where Stevens informed them that he was injured and would miss some races. Bell admitted that nobody was expecting such news.

Bell has had a successful 2024 NASCAR Cup season, winning three races so far. He hopes that Stevens’ injury will not hinder their progress. It will be interesting to see how the No:20 team performs without the physical presence of their crew chief.
